?
Arduino Mega2560上的ATmega2560已经预置了bootloader程序,因此可以通过Arduino软件直接下载程序到Mega2560中,参见[[]]。
?
可以直接通过Mega2560上ICSP header直接下载程序到ATmega2560,参见[[]]。
?
ATmega16U2的Firmware(固件)也可以通过DFU工具升级,参见[[]]。
物理特征
Arduino Mega2560的最大尺寸为4 x 2.1 inches。 注意要点
Arduino Mega2560上USB口附近有一个可重置的保险丝,对电路起到保护作用。当电流超过500mA是会断开USB连接。
?
?
Arduino Mega2560提供了自动复位设计,可以通过主机复位。这样通过Arduino软件下在程序到Mega2560中软件可以自动复位,不需要在复位按钮。在印制板上丝印\处可以使能和禁止该功能。
?
Arduino Mega2560的设计与Arduino USB接口标准版的设计完全兼容,因此用于Arduino UNO和之前系列的扩展板也可以用在Arduino Mega2560上。
扩展阅读
http://arduino.cc/en/Main/ArduinoBoardMega2560 附件:ATmega2560-Arduino 引脚图 Below is the pin mapping for the Atmega2560. The chip used in Arduino 2560. There are pin mappings to Atmega8 andAtmega 168/328 as well. Arduino Mega 2560 PIN diagram The source SVG file is also available for download: PinMapping2560.zip Arduino Mega 2560 PIN mapping table Pin Number Pin Name Mapped Pin Name Digital pin 4 1 PG5 ( OC0B ) (PWM) Digital pin 0 2 PE0 ( RXD0/PCINT8 ) (RX0) Digital pin 1 3 PE1 ( TXD0 ) (TX0) 4 PE2 ( XCK0/AIN0 ) Digital pin 5 5 PE3 ( OC3A/AIN1 ) (PWM) 6 PE4 ( OC3B/INT4 ) Digital pin 2 (PWM) Digital pin 3 7 PE5 ( OC3C/INT5 ) (PWM) 8 9 10 11 PE6 ( T3/INT6 ) PE7 ( CLKO/ICP3/INT7 ) VCC GND VCC GND Digital pin 17 12 PH0 ( RXD2 ) (RX2) Digital pin 16 13 PH1 ( TXD2 ) (TX2) 14 PH2 ( XCK2 ) Digital pin 6 15 PH3 ( OC4A ) (PWM) Digital pin 7 16 PH4 ( OC4B ) (PWM) Digital pin 8 17 PH5 ( OC4C ) (PWM) Digital pin 9 18 PH6 ( OC2B ) (PWM) 19 PB0 ( SS/PCINT0 ) Digital pin 53 (SS) Digital pin 52 20 PB1 ( SCK/PCINT1 ) (SCK) Digital pin 51 21 PB2 ( MOSI/PCINT2 ) (MOSI) Digital pin 50 22 PB3 ( MISO/PCINT3 ) (MISO) Digital pin 10 23 PB4 ( OC2A/PCINT4 ) (PWM) Digital pin 11 24 PB5 ( OC1A/PCINT5 ) (PWM) Digital pin 12 25 PB6 ( OC1B/PCINT6 ) (PWM) PB7 ( OC0A/OC1C/PCINT7 26 ) 27 28 29 30 31 32 PH7 ( T4 ) PG3 ( TOSC2 ) PG4 ( TOSC1 ) RESET VCC GND RESET VCC GND (PWM) Digital pin 13 33 34 35 36 37 XTAL2 XTAL1 PL0 ( ICP4 ) PL1 ( ICP5 ) PL2 ( T5 ) XTAL2 XTAL1 Digital pin 49 Digital pin 48 Digital pin 47 Digital pin 46 38 PL3 ( OC5A ) (PWM) Digital pin 45 39 PL4 ( OC5B ) (PWM) Digital pin 44 40 PL5 ( OC5C ) (PWM) 41 42 PL6 PL7 Digital pin 43 Digital pin 42 Digital pin 21 43 PD0 ( SCL/INT0 ) (SCL) Digital pin 20 44 PD1 ( SDA/INT1 ) (SDA) Digital pin 19 45 PD2 ( RXDI/INT2 ) (RX1) Digital pin 18 46 PD3 ( TXD1/INT3 ) (TX1)
Arduino - Mega - 2560使用手册



